A new offering from award-winning author Jayne Anne Phillips, set during the American Civil War and seen through the eyes of ConaLee, a teenage girl in the divided state of Virginia, whose father is away fighting for the Union.

Kate - whose care for her terminally ill mother coincides with the birth of her first child in the early months of a young marriage - must, in a single year, come to terms with radiant beginnings and profound loss. Kate's everyday world is enveloped by the gradual vanishing of her mother.

This is the chronicle of an American family moving inexorably towards dissolution. A succession of voices, Jean, Mitch, Danner and Billy, moves a narrative from the 1950s, 1960s and 1970s towards the national cataclysm of Vietnam.

Set in the 1950s in West Virginia and Korea, "Lark and Termite" is a story of the power of loss and love, the echoing ramifications of war, family secrets, dreams and ghosts, and the unseen, almost magical bonds that unite and sustain a family.
